Why Good Sound Matters in Videos
When people think about great videos, they often focus on visuals first. But sound is just as important — sometimes even more important. A video with stunning visuals but poor audio can quickly lose viewers. Clear, balanced sound helps keep audiences engaged and makes content feel professional.
Good sound improves communication. Whether it’s dialogue, narration, or background music, viewers need to clearly understand what they hear. Muffled voices, loud background noise, or uneven audio levels can distract from the message and make videos difficult to enjoy.
Audio also creates emotion and atmosphere. Music, ambient sounds, and sound effects help build tension, excitement, happiness, or suspense. Imagine a dramatic scene without music or a travel video without environmental sounds — the experience would feel flat and incomplete.
Professional sound increases credibility. Businesses, creators, and filmmakers who invest in quality audio often appear more trustworthy and polished. In fact, viewers are more likely to forgive average visuals than poor sound quality.
Simple improvements can make a big difference. Using an external microphone, recording in a quiet environment, and editing audio carefully can dramatically improve the final result. Even basic sound optimization helps videos feel more engaging and easier to watch.
In the end, great sound is not just an extra feature — it is a core part of effective storytelling. Clear, immersive audio helps videos connect with audiences and leaves a lasting impression.
